eBook promotion is a skill any eBook author must learn if they wish their book to be successful.
Here i present 5 eBook marketing strategies.
1) Article Marketing.
This method is quite simply amazing.
You simply write as many articles as you can about your eBook topic and include a back link to your e book web page. Bear in mind that quantity is key, but it goes hand in hand with quality. It is no good to write lots of articles if they are of no use to the reader, this will lead to few clicks on your back link. It is also of little point to write a few great articles because the traffic will be obviously less than if you have a lot of articles. Write many, write well.
2) Community Forums.
Join online forums that are based around your eBook topic. If your eBook is about fishing, then go to a fishing forum and join in the conversations. The rules here are simple. Be a useful and active member. Do not be a spammer. You will be disliked and probably banned very quickly. Contribute to the community and be useful and polite. Of course do not forget to add your all important back link into your signature.
3) Social Marketing.
Set up a Face book page or Twitter account and build a following. Again, be useful and informative. Do not just bombard your followers with adverts for your eBook. They are following you to learn from you, not to buy from you. Though if you build the trust with your knowledge then sales will follow. Obey the rules on promotion.
4) Pay per click.
One of the tried and tested eBook marketing strategies. Pay per click can drive targeted customers to your eBook like few other methods. But it of course comes at a price. The wise way of doing this is to set your daily budget low to begin with and to heavily research your keywords before bidding on them. You would be surprised how much major keywords can cost per click. You will also be pleasantly surprised just how cheap some keywords can be when you find them. Research, and research well before jumping head first into this eBook marketing strategy.
5) Free ad sites.
Many eBook authors overlook this great promotion method. There are many free ad sites on the internet, but not all are created equal when it comes to traffic. Some of the top sites will literally flood your site with traffic, others will provide a trickle at best. Most free ad sites also offer packages that will contain their best promotion features, of course at a fee, but this is usually small and pays itself back very quickly with the right product.
